About Khaled Al‐Shaibi

Khaled Al‐Shaibi is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Surgery, having authored 27 papers that have together received 321 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Coronary Interventions and Diagnostics (12 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(8 papers),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(8 papers), Infective Endocarditis Diagnosis and Management (6 papers), Acute Myocardial Infarction Research (6 papers), Antiplatelet Therapy and Cardiovascular Diseases (4 papers), Congenital Heart Disease Studies (3 papers) and Aortic Disease and Treatment Approaches (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(174 citations), Internal Medicine (25 citations) and Surgery (224 citations). Khaled Al‐Shaibi has collaborated with scholars based in Saudi Arabia, United States and Kuwait. Frequent co-authors include Sara C. Martinez, Mirvat Alasnag, Larry S. Dean, Sriram S. Iyer, Ming W. Liu, Gary S. Roubin, Suresh P. Jain, Waqar Ahmed, Qurat‐ul‐ain Jelani and Jay S. Yadav. Their work appears in journals such as Circulation,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Scientific Reports.
